Phoenixville, PA – One of our favorite bands is JD Malone and the Experts (we have no idea why they aren’t worldwide famous!) and they are from -you guessed it-Phoenixville! We decided to check it out with our good friend Wendy. First-I love Murals! I had no idea Phoenixville is known for murals, so you can imagine my delight to find the buildings covered with beautiful art!

 

 

 

We parked the FIFTY5 Bug (we suggest you use one of the parking lots-street parking is limited) and strolled down Bridge street to check everything out- the first thing you notice are the breweries-They are everywhere! We stopped in at Bridge Street Chocolates and met the owner Gail-she was a huge source of information about the town and her chocolate was amazing (more of her story to come later in the magazineJ). She told us to not miss The Foundry, which houses the Schuylkill River Heritage Center for local history and she was right!

 

The Foundry

What a beautiful building with lots of information about the area. http://phoenixvillefoundry.com/ We continued along the walking/bike trail, stopped by a farmer’s market and then happened upon one of the largest beer stores we have ever seen- the Foodery- www.fooderybeer.com. 

 

 

BEER EVERYWHERE!

As you walk along bridge street and see the colonial theater-you might get the eerie sense of having been there before…as the 1957 setting for the BLOB Phoenixville will always have its place in cinematic history! I will definitely go back just to see a movie (so happy it is still a working movie theater!) so I can say I was there-adding that to my bucket list! https://thecolonialtheatre.com/

 

We finished off our day at the Great American Pub Bar & Grill outside area with local beer and live music-two of our favorite things after a day of sight seeing! http://www.phoenixville.org/
